7 hours ago, Shelly97060 said:

I am curious how passengers who fail to enter information into Arrivecan  prior to arriving at check in are being handled if anyone happens to notice.  Are Princess reps assisting ?  I know some people choose to have all Medallion information entered by Princess at the Port, my guess is there will be some who don’t do Arrivecan in advance as well. 

ArriveCAN was not checked when checking in at the pier. During the cruise there was an info sheet detailing what needed to be done. If you already did it please check in at Guest Services with the QR code, if not please complete it. That was the only time it was ever asked about. No one asked a thing when we got off the ship in Victoria.
